I just finished my v8 with an automatic trans swap, with many issues I might add. I have one big one left. I bought a 4406 high-low speed transfer case instead of using the AWD transfer case that came with the donor to put into the Ranger. The ranger already had the electronic setup so I thought everything would be fine. Much to my dismay it is not. The 4406 has a square plug with 6 green and green grey wires that the Ranger round plug did not. The core wires on the electronic control unit (8 of them) at the transfer case are exactly the same. My question is, which wires do I have to use in order to get it to work. One of the things I did do was to change the electric shift motor from the 1354 and bolted it onto the 4406 with no issues other than those pesky extra wires. I do not know what they are for and have been told by several know it all's that I don't need them, "just cut them off and it will work". Needless to say that is bunk. Is there anyone that can help me with this issue? Or does anyone know a solution?
2nd question would be I get a P0743 Torque Converter Clutch Circuit error code. Any ideas?
